About this course

Learners will gain a deep understanding of various movement-based instruction methods, enabling them to develop and implement effective exercise programs for diverse populations. The course covers crucial topics such as functional anatomy, biomechanics, program design, and correction techniques, ensuring that learners are well-prepared to meet the needs of clients in various settings. Upon completion, learners will possess a valuable credential that demonstrates their expertise in movement-based instruction, a sought-after skill set in fitness clubs, rehabilitation centers, and wellness programs. By developing the ability to design and implement effective exercise programs, learners will be poised to make a meaningful impact on the health and well-being of their clients while advancing their careers in this growing field.

Course Details

• Understanding Movement-Based Instruction: An Overview
• Principles of Biomechanics in Movement-Based Activities
• Designing Effective Movement-Based Lesson Plans
• Active Techniques for Engaging Students in Movement
• Assessment and Evaluation in Movement-Based Instruction
• Promoting Motor Skill Development through Active Techniques
• Enhancing Cognitive Function through Movement-Based Instruction
• Adapting Movement-Based Instruction for Inclusive Classrooms
• Best Practices for Safety and Injury Prevention in Movement-Based Activities
